Plate Tectonics

QuestionAnswer
What is the name of the supercontinent that was once one large landmass? Pangaea
What theory explained how continents once fit together like a puzzle? Continental Drift
What theory focused on explaining how mountains formed? Geosyncline Theory
What is a small downward fold in rock? syncline

What is the process of new ocean floor moving across the ocean floor? Seafloor Spreading
What comes up through the mid atlantic ridge creating new ocean floor? Magma
Who came up with the Continental Drift Theory? Alfred Wegner
What is the process of ocean crust sinking into the mantle under the continental crust? Subduction
What geological formation is formed at a subduction zone? trench
What changes direction at various times throughout history? Magnetic Poles
What was used during WWII to help map the bottom of the seafloor? Sonar
What type of boundary is moving away from each other? Divergent
What type of boundary is moving toward each other? Convergent
What evidence is there that supports that land on Earth was once all connected? Fossil Record
What is a chain of underwater mountains? Mid-ocean Ridge

Where does the magnetic field originate? Earth's Core
What are the two types of crust? Oceanic and Continental
